On this day in 1993, Jeffrey Hammonds became an instrument of karmic justice as he lined a foul ball off the face of Glenn Davis, who was sitting in the dugout at the time of impact. Cal Ripken, Jr. played his 2,000th consecutive game on 8/1/94.  Mike Mussina struck out 15 and allowed one hit in a 10-0 shutout of the Twins on 8/1/00.

You should have a slice pie in honor of the birthday of Adam Jones. George Bamberger, innovator of the Staten Island Sinker (aka spitball) and O's pitching coach from 1968-1977 was an August 1 baby. Travis Driskil and Tony Muser also celebrate birthdays today.
